Base Class: Artificer

Eldritch Gunsmiths are artificers who have delved into the unfathomable realms of the Eldrazi, ancient beings of cosmic horror and power. By infusing their mechanical creations with the chaotic and destructive energies of the void, these artificers become formidable warriors, wielding weapons that can warp reality and annihilate their enemies. They craft eldritch cannons that spew necrotic energy and devastate the battlefield, blending their technological prowess with the dark powers of the Eldrazi.

Eldritch Gunsmiths are often solitary figures, drawn to places where the veil between worlds is thin. They seek out knowledge and relics of the Eldrazi, using their understanding of these ancient beings to protect the world from extraplanar threats. Yet, they walk a fine line, as every creation, every spell, brings them closer to the void, threatening to consume their very essence. They are both revered and feared, their presence a reminder of the thin veil that separates the known world from the cosmic horrors that lie beyond.

Tool Proficiency

3rd-level Eldritch Gunsmith feature

You gain proficiency with woodcarver’s tools. If you already have this proficiency, you gain proficiency with one other type of artisan’s tools of your choice.

Eldritch Gunsmith Spells

3rd-level Eldritch Gunsmith feature

You always have certain spells prepared after you reach particular levels in this class, as shown in the Eldritch Gunsmith Spells table. These spells count as artificer spells for you, but they don’t count against the number of artificer spells you prepare.

Cosmic Cannon

3rd-level Eldritch Gunsmith feature

Starting at 3rd level, you learn how to create a Cosmic Cannon, a device of dark, otherworldly power. Using smith’s tools or woodcarver’s tools, you can take an action to magically create a Small or Tiny Cosmic Cannon in an unoccupied space on a horizontal surface within 5 feet of you.

When you create the cannon, you determine its appearance and whether it has legs. You also decide which type it is, choosing from the options on the Cosmic Cannon table. On each of your turns, you can take a bonus action to cause the cannon to activate if you are within 60 feet of it. As part of the same bonus action, you can direct the cannon to walk or climb up to 15 feet to an unoccupied space, provided it has legs.

You can create a number of Cosmic Cannons equal to your proficiency bonus, and you can’t create one while at your maximum number. You can create a new one after you finish a long rest or by expending a spell slot of 1st level or higher. If you create a new cannon, the previous one becomes inactive.

Cosmic Cannons

Cannon Activation

Necrotic Goo

The cannon spews forth a jet of necrotic energy in a 15-foot cone. Each creature in that area must make a Dexterity saving throw against your spell save DC, taking necrotic damage equal to 2d8 + your Intelligence modifier on a failed save, or half as much damage on a successful one. The necrotic energy corrodes and destroys organic matter, leaving a trail of decay.

Necrotic Projectile

Make a ranged spell attack originating from the cannon at one creature or object within 120 feet. On a hit, the target takes 2d10 necrotic damage and is pushed 5 feet away from the cannon. The projectile is a concentrated bolt of eldritch energy that disintegrates anything in its path.

Necrotic Burst

The cannon emits a burst of necrotic energy in a 10-foot radius around it, which restores 1d8 + your Intelligence modifier hit points to each creature of your choice in that area. This energy siphons life from the void, rejuvenating allies and leaving an eerie afterglow.

Eldritch Firearm

5th-level Eldritch Gunsmith feature

At 5th level, you gain the ability to imbue a firearm with the power of the void. As an action, you can touch a wand, staff, or rod and transform it into your Eldritch Firearm. You can use your Eldritch Firearm as a spellcasting focus for your artificer spells. When you cast an artificer spell through the Eldritch Firearm, you gain a bonus to one of the spell’s damage rolls equal to your Intelligence modifier (minimum of +1).

Additionally, when you cast an artificer spell using the Eldritch Firearm, you can reroll one of the damage dice and use either result.

Void Cannon

9th-level Eldritch Gunsmith feature

Starting at 9th level, your Eldritch Cannons become more destructive. Once per turn, when you activate your Eldritch Cannon, you can cause it to unleash a void explosion. When you do so, the cannon detonates in a 20-foot-radius sphere centered on it. Each creature in that area must make a Dexterity saving throw against your spell save DC, taking 4d10 force damage on a failed save, or half as much damage on a successful one. The explosion leaves behind a void-scarred area, distorting reality.

Once you use this feature, you can’t use it again until you finish a long rest or until you expend a spell slot of 3rd level or higher to use it again.

Cosmic Fortification

15th-level Eldritch Gunsmith feature

By 15th level, you have learned to draw upon the infinite energies of the void to fortify your defenses and those of your allies. When you or any friendly creature within 30 feet of you is subjected to an effect that allows it to make a saving throw to take only half damage, you can use your reaction to grant it advantage on the saving throw. Additionally, when a creature gains this benefit, it takes no damage on a successful save and half damage on a failed save.

You can use this feature a number of times equal to your Intelligence modifier (minimum of once), and you regain all expended uses when you finish a long rest.
